Nucleus
• Contains the genes that control the cell; localizing the cell’s DNA
• Nuclear envelope
- separates the nucleus contents from cytoplasm
- double membrane with pores to regulate what enters and exits nucleus
![Page 45: Microscopes. Field of View Fly’s Foot Surface of an Erasable Programmable Read-Only Memory Silicon microchip.](https://reader033.fdocuments.net/reader033/viewer/2022051401/56649e495503460f94b3cb35/html5/thumbnails/45.jpg)
Nucleus
• Nucleolus – densely packed RNA and proteins that makes up ribosomes
• Chromatin: threads of DNA that makes up the chromosomes and their associated proteins (histones)

Endomembrane System• Membranes physically touch one another
or transfer membrane segments through tiny vessicles
• Includes:- Nuclear envelope- Endoplasmic reticulum- Golgi apparatus- Lysosomes- Peroxisomes- Cell membrane

Endoplasmic Reticulum
• Membranous labryinth extending from the nuclear membrane
• Made of tubes and sacs called cisternae
![Page 50: Microscopes. Field of View Fly’s Foot Surface of an Erasable Programmable Read-Only Memory Silicon microchip.](https://reader033.fdocuments.net/reader033/viewer/2022051401/56649e495503460f94b3cb35/html5/thumbnails/50.jpg)
Rough ER: ribosomes stud the cytoplasmic surface
• Many types of specialized cells secrete proteins made by the rough ER which are moved in transport vesicles
• As the polypeptide chain grows from the ribosomes, it goes into the ERs cisternal space and folds into higher levels
• Some proteins (glycoproteins) are covalently bonded to carbohydrates or are embedded in newly synthesized lipid membranes
![Page 51: Microscopes. Field of View Fly’s Foot Surface of an Erasable Programmable Read-Only Memory Silicon microchip.](https://reader033.fdocuments.net/reader033/viewer/2022051401/56649e495503460f94b3cb35/html5/thumbnails/51.jpg)
Smooth ER: cytoplasmic surface lacks ribosomes
• Function:
- synthesis of phospholipids and steroids
-carbohydrate metabolism,
-detoxification of drugs/poisons
![Page 52: Microscopes. Field of View Fly’s Foot Surface of an Erasable Programmable Read-Only Memory Silicon microchip.](https://reader033.fdocuments.net/reader033/viewer/2022051401/56649e495503460f94b3cb35/html5/thumbnails/52.jpg)
Ribosomes
• Sites where cells assemble proteins according to genetic instructions
• Free ribosomes are suspended in the cytoplasm which make proteins that will function in the cytosol
• Bound ribosomes are attached to the endoplasmic reticulum which make proteins that be included in membranes or transported outside the cell

Golgi Apparatus
• Flattened, inner-connected membranous sacks with cisternae
• Products of ER are modified, stored, and shipped via transport vesicles
• Secretory vesicles have “docking sites” that recognize the surface of specific organelles
![Page 55: Microscopes. Field of View Fly’s Foot Surface of an Erasable Programmable Read-Only Memory Silicon microchip.](https://reader033.fdocuments.net/reader033/viewer/2022051401/56649e495503460f94b3cb35/html5/thumbnails/55.jpg)
Lysosome
• Membrane-enclosed bag of hydrolytic enzymes that digests macromolecules
• Works best in an environment with pH = 5
• Amoeba eat via phagocytosis = engulf food then digest as the lysosome fuses to it
• Usually only found in animals

Peroxisome
• Contains enzymes that transfer hydrogen from various substrates to oxygen, producing H2O2
• The H2O2 is then converted into water
• Helps breakdown fats to be used in mitochondria for energy
• Detoxify alcohol in the liver

Mitochondria
• Site of cellular respiration which generates ATP from sugars and fats
• Have ribosomes and small amounts of DNA for its own protein synthesis
• 100s-1000s per cell which correlate to the metabolic activity of the cell
• Enclosed in phospholipid bi-layer with inner foldings called cristae

Chloroplasts• Convert solar energy into chemical energy
by absorbing sunlight and using it to synthesize glucose from CO2 and H2O.
• Plastids: specialized organelles in plants- Leucoplasts: store starch in roots and tubers- Chromoplasts: enriched in pigments that give plants their colors- Chloroplasts: contain the green pigment cholorphyll

Vacuole
• Central vacuole: stores water, organic compounds, ions, wastes, and hydrolytic enzymes
• Tonoplast: membrane surrounding plant vacuole
• Vacuoles and vesicles are both membranous sacs, but vacuoles are larger

Cytoskeleton• Network of fibers that allow for material
movement within the cell• microtubules – larger filaments that help
• move organelles during cell division • form hair-like extensions on cell surface for
movement (cilia or flagella)• Centrioles – rings of microtubules which form
spindle fibers to aide in cell division
• Microfilaments (actin) – smaller filaments that maintain shape and aid in muscle contraction

Cell Wall
• Made of cellulose (polysaccharide) not digested by most animals
• Rigid structure that supports and protects plant cell by preventing the excess uptake of water- turgor pressure from vacuole assists in support
• Allows movement of materials in/out of cell through plasmodesmata (channels)
![Page 72: Microscopes. Field of View Fly’s Foot Surface of an Erasable Programmable Read-Only Memory Silicon microchip.](https://reader033.fdocuments.net/reader033/viewer/2022051401/56649e495503460f94b3cb35/html5/thumbnails/72.jpg)
Cytoplasm
• Cytosol: semi-fluid medium in which organelles are suspended
• Mostly water but also contains ions, sugars, amino acids, RNA, and ATP (cell energy)
